The Medical Science Liaison Will

  • Develop and maintain a strategic and comprehensive territory plan and will build strong relationships with various community and academic opinion leaders/ KOLs in the territory.
  • Engage in high-level scientific and research discussions with KOLs and OLs to serve as a resource for them and to understand their perspectives on the current treatment landscape in the relevant disease area.
  • Identify provider educational needs and address those with tailored responses.
  • Deliver relevant scientific data tailored to HCP needs through clear and effective dialog/ presentation.
  • Consistently execute upon the current Medical Affairs strategy and MSL priorities
  • Respond to unsolicited research/clinical inquiries from external stakeholders promptly.
  • Collect and submit high quality actionable insights aligned with current strategic priorities of the organization.
  • Utilize insights and MSL tools to develop a strategic approach for customer engagements within territory.
  • Provide research support for company-sponsored and investigator-initiated studies.
  • Compliantly collaborate with internal stakeholders including but not limited to MSL field partners, R&D, US as well as Global Medical Affairs teams, clinical operations, sales, and marketing teams
  • Demonstrate strong scientific acumen through self-reading, engaging in journal clubs, attending educational seminars, attending local and national congresses, and engaging in scientific discussion with peers.
  • Will foster a culture of inclusion and belonging (internally and externally), increasing engagement, productivity and innovation that reflects the diverse communities we serve.
  • Develop a thorough understanding and competence in the following areas -regulatory and health care compliance guidelines; corporate policies on appropriate business conduct and ethical behavior; Medical Affairs SOPs and guidelines.
  • In collaboration with direct manager, MSL will develop and implement a performance and development plan as well as conduct additional leadership projects.
  • Perform all administrative requirements in a timely, accurate and compliant manner (e.g. expense reports, documentation of activities)
